Analysis

In 2020, 3.1.1 maternal mortality ratio in Cameroon stood at 438.

That represents a change of down 0.4% on the previous year and down 16.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, 3.1.1 maternal mortality ratio in Cameroon peaked at 650.73 in 2000 and was at its lowest, 423.89, in 2018.

That places Cameroon 21st out of 184 countries with data for 2020, putting it in the top qu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 21 years of available data.

3.1.1 Maternal mortality ratio in Cameroon, year by year

Annual values for 3.1.1 Maternal mortality ratio (deaths per 100,000 live births) in Cameroon, 2000 to 2020.
Year Value Change
2000 650.73
2001 629.25 -3.3%
2002 610.57 -3.0%
2003 574.42 -5.9%
2004 555.62 -3.3%
2005 572.95 +3.1%
2006 558.27 -2.6%
2007 528.86 -5.3%
2008 531.9 +0.6%
2009 533.66 +0.3%
2010 526.75 -1.3%
2011 518.68 -1.5%
2012 487.1 -6.1%
2013 490.71 +0.7%
2014 477.51 -2.7%
2015 446.85 -6.4%
2016 437.25 -2.1%
2017 442.97 +1.3%
2018 423.89 -4.3%
2019 439.77 +3.7%
2020 438 -0.4%
